In this study, the imaging of simulated surface-subsurface combined defects using a photoacoustic microscope has been demonstrated. A surface vertical defect is fabricated on a metal specimen surface by mechanical processing. The subsurface defect was made perpendicular to the surface defect by drilling. The surface defect and the subsurface defect were relevantly distinguishable in the photoacoustic amplitude image obtained using the photoacoustic microscope. The size of the subsurface defect and information on the undersurface structure were obtained.
